#71b585 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#71b585 is composed of 44.3% red, 71% green and 52.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 26.5%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 137.6 degrees, a saturation of 31.5% and a lightness of 57.6%. #71b585 color hex could be obtained by blending #e2ffff with #006b0b.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#71b585

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070d08 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
